		<description>There are many new foreign SMEs being registered in the Philippines, the majority of them coming from the US.  Other foreign SMEs are coming from Canada, Northern Europe and Expat owned companies from Singapore and Hong Kong. We are even starting to see contact centers from the India registering businesses in the Philippines as the labor cost is cheaper and the English is much better</description>
